   
    #content_column,
    #layout_wrapper #page_content {
    margin: 0px !important;
    padding: 5px !important;
    width: 100% !important;
    max-width: 100% !important;
   
    }

.layout-wrapper2 {
max-width:90rem;
margin-left:auto;
margin-right:auto;
}

#ctl00_crumb_trail_container{
display:none !important;
}

.layout-widget ul.site-menu {
text-transform: uppercase !important;

}

footer, .footer-container {
background-color:#000000;
color:#ffffff !important;
}

.footer-container span, .footer-container a{
color:#ffffff !important;
}


.bottom-container {
border-top:1px solid #000000;
}
.bottom-container a {
color:#fff;
text-decoration:none;
font-weight:bold;
line-height:1.5;
}
.footer-container, .footer-container a, .footer-container span {
    color: #000;
}

.top-container .template-column.third img {
max-width:130px;
}
.ce-button {background:none;border:none;}